Я только что получил учебник в формате PDF, состоящий из примерно 20 отдельных файлов (по главам) с квазирегулярными именами. Есть ли способ подсчета страниц в книге без открытия каждого файла (или просмотра свойств)?
[решение может быть для Windows или Ubuntu]
Ответы:
Используя
pdfinfo
это лучшее, что я мог придумать: Чтобы напечатать количество страниц в файле:Чтобы распечатать сумму всех страниц во всех файлах:
На Ubuntu,
pdfinfo
содержится в пакетеpoppler-utils
. Чтобы установить его, используйте:В Windows вы можете использовать Cygwin.
pdfinfo
содержится в упаковкеpoppler
.источник
Я знаю, что уже слишком поздно, но я нашел способ лучше и проще для этого.
Загрузите и установите из sourceforge "pdf split and merge"
Перетащите все свои файлы на него, и на экране он создаст отчет в виде электронной таблицы о количестве страниц и информации о каждом из них.
Выберите это, скопируйте, вставьте в Excel или OpenCalc, вы получили это.
источник
Я сделал приложение только для этого, он написан на Java, поэтому работает на всех ОС. Проверьте это здесь:
https://github.com/hamiltino/multiple-pdf-counter/releases
Лучше всего запустить приложение из терминала (
java -jar
), чтобы убедиться, что оно будет работать правильно.Поместите файл jar в каталог, в котором вы хотите получить количество страниц всех PDF-файлов. Он также будет циклически перемещаться по подпапкам, нет необходимости размещать все PDF-файлы там, где находится файл JAR, так как он будет циклически перемещаться по подпапкам, в которые вы помещаете фляга Дважды щелкните по банке, это может занять некоторое время, если есть много файлов PDF, в конечном итоге он выведет файл TXT в тот же каталог файла JAR, и он будет иметь количество страниц в нем.
источник
В Adobe Acrobat Pro перейдите к файлу > создать PDF > объединить файлы в один PDF . Затем добавьте файлы и выберите нужные файлы. Нажмите объединить, и посмотрите, сколько страниц в окончательном PDF.
источник
Привет не знаю, как вы можете сделать это на Windows, но на Linux Bash это должно работать с этим
С наилучшими пожеланиями Кенни
источник
другой подход с
parallel
иexpr
(должен быть немного быстрее на многопроцессорных машинах):источник